			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>One day back in April of 2004, my wife was working in the garden when a stray dog walked up and lay down nearby.  Normally she&#8217;s scared of stray animals, but in this case she just kept working while the little dog fell asleep.  This is how our life with Puppy Dog began, and this is how the Graham Dog Park began.</p>
<p>The next summer my wife approached the Graham Recreation and Parks Commission with a proposal to build a dog park along with over 1,000 signatures we had gathered from people in support of the idea.  The Commission put together a working group to look further into the park, and that group, working with the Recreation and Parks Department have come up with the park now under development.</p>
<p>It has been a long time in the making, but we are now ready to see the park become reality.  All that is left is raising the money necessary to build the park.  I know that we will achieve our goal and build the park that our dogs and our community deserves.</p>
